Things you didn’t know about St. Louis.
5. St. Louis was once the fourth-largest city in the U.S.
In the late 1800s, thanks to its location as a hub for westward expansion and river trade, St. Louis rivaled cities like Boston and San Francisco in size and influence. Its boom shaped much of the historic architecture still seen today.
4. The Gateway Arch is taller than you think.
Clocking in at 630 feet, the Arch is taller than the Statue of Liberty and the Washington Monument. Even more fascinating? You can ride a tiny tram to the top — a quirky, capsule-like elevator that feels like a time machine.
3. Provel cheese is a St. Louis invention.
It’s not mozzarella, provolone, or Swiss — it’s Provel, and locals are fiercely loyal to it. Especially when it comes to St. Louis-style pizza: ultra-thin crust, square-cut, and topped with that gooey, smoky cheese blend.
2. There’s an entire underground network of caves beneath the city.
Long before prohibition-era speakeasies, these natural caves were used for beer storage and escape routes. You can still tour parts of them today and feel the chill of forgotten history beneath your feet.
1. The 1904 World’s Fair changed American culture forever.
Held in St. Louis, this iconic event introduced millions to the first-ever ice cream cone, hot dogs, iced tea, and even x-ray machines. It wasn’t just a fair — it was a turning point in how Americans experienced the world.
